Proyectos de Subversion LeadersLinked - Services

Rev

Rev 598 | Ir a la última revisión | Mostrar el archivo completo | | | Autoría | Ultima modificación | Ver Log |

Rev 598 Rev 602
Línea 1122... Línea 1122...
1122
        return new JsonModel($response);
1122
        return new JsonModel($response);
1123
    }*/
1123
    }*/
Línea 1124... Línea 1124...
1124
 
1124
 
1125
    public function timelineAction()
1125
    public function timelineAction()
1126
    {
-
 
1127
        
-
 
1128
 
-
 
1129
        
-
 
-
 
1126
    {
Línea 1130... Línea 1127...
1130
        
1127
        $request = $this->getRequest();
1131
 
1128
 
Línea 1132... Línea -...
1132
        $currentUserPlugin = $this->plugin('currentUserPlugin');
-
 
1133
        $currentUser = $currentUserPlugin->getUser();
1129
        $currentUserPlugin = $this->plugin('currentUserPlugin');
1134
 
-
 
1135
 
-
 
1136
        $type   = $this->params()->fromRoute('type');
-
 
1137
        if ($type == 'user') {
1130
        $currentUser = $currentUserPlugin->getUser();
1138
            $id = $currentUser->id;
-
 
1139
        } else {
-
 
1140
            $id     = $this->params()->fromRoute('id');
-
 
1141
        }
1131
 
Línea 1142... Línea -...
1142
 
-
 
-
 
1132
        $type   = $this->params()->fromRoute('type');
Línea 1143... Línea 1133...
1143
        $feedHighlighted = 0;
1133
        $id = $type == 'user' ? $currentUser->id : $this->params()->fromRoute('id');
1144
        $feedUuid = $this->params()->fromRoute('feed');
1134
        $feedUuid = $this->params()->fromRoute('feed');
1145
 
1135
 
Línea 1156... Línea 1146...
1156
            }
1146
            }
1157
        }
1147
        }
Línea 1158... Línea -...
1158
 
-
 
1159
 
1148
 
1160
 
-
 
1161
        $request = $this->getRequest();
1149
 
1162
        if ($request->isGet()) {
1150
 
Línea 1163... Línea 1151...
1163
            
1151
        if ($request->isGet()) {
1164
            $userBlockedMapper = UserBlockedMapper::getInstance($this->adapter);
1152
            $userBlockedMapper = UserBlockedMapper::getInstance($this->adapter);
Línea 1165... Línea 1153...
1165
            $user_blocked_ids = $userBlockedMapper->fetchAllBlockedReturnIds($currentUser->id);
1153
            $user_blocked_ids = $userBlockedMapper->fetchAllBlockedReturnIds($currentUser->id);
Línea 1166... Línea -...
1166
            
-
 
1167
            $abuseReportMapper = AbuseReportMapper::getInstance($this->adapter);
-
 
1168
            $abuse_report_feed_ids = $abuseReportMapper->fetchAllDataByUserReportingIdAndTypeReturnIds($currentUser->id, AbuseReport::TYPE_FEED);
1154
            
Línea 1169... Línea 1155...
1169
            
1155
            $abuseReportMapper = AbuseReportMapper::getInstance($this->adapter);
Línea 1170... Línea 1156...
1170
            $abuse_report_comment_ids = $abuseReportMapper->fetchAllDataByUserReportingIdAndTypeReturnIds($currentUser->id, AbuseReport::TYPE_COMMENT);
1156
            $abuse_report_feed_ids = $abuseReportMapper->fetchAllDataByUserReportingIdAndTypeReturnIds($currentUser->id, AbuseReport::TYPE_FEED);
Línea 1180... Línea 1166...
1180
            $selectNotUserCompany->from(['cu' => CompanyUserMapper::_TABLE]);
1166
            $selectNotUserCompany->from(['cu' => CompanyUserMapper::_TABLE]);
Línea 1181... Línea 1167...
1181
  
1167
  
1182
            $selectNotUserCompany->where->equalTo('user_id', $currentUser->id);
1168
            $selectNotUserCompany->where->equalTo('user_id', $currentUser->id);
Línea 1183... Línea -...
1183
            $selectNotUserCompany->where->in('status', [CompanyUser::STATUS_ACCEPTED, CompanyUser::STATUS_ADMIN_WILL_ADD]);
-
 
1184
            
-
 
1185
            
-
 
1186
            
-
 
1187
            
1169
            $selectNotUserCompany->where->in('status', [CompanyUser::STATUS_ACCEPTED, CompanyUser::STATUS_ADMIN_WILL_ADD]);
1188
            
1170
            
1189
            $select = $queryMapper->getSql()->select();
1171
            $select = $queryMapper->getSql()->select();
1190
            $select->columns(['id']);
1172
            $select->columns(['id']);
1191
            $select->from(['f' => FeedMapper::_TABLE]);
1173
            $select->from(['f' => FeedMapper::_TABLE]);
Línea 1494... Línea 1476...
1494
 
1476
 
1495
        $userMapper = UserMapper::getInstance($this->adapter);
1477
        $userMapper = UserMapper::getInstance($this->adapter);
1496
        $feedMapper = FeedMapper::getInstance($this->adapter);
1478
        $feedMapper = FeedMapper::getInstance($this->adapter);
Línea 1497... Línea -...
1497
        $feed = $feedMapper->fetchOneAnyStatus($feed_id);
-
 
1498
 
-
 
1499
 
1479
        $feed = $feedMapper->fetchOneAnyStatus($feed_id);
Línea 1500... Línea 1480...
1500
 
1480
 
1501
        $storage = \LeadersLinked\Library\Storage::getInstance($this->config, $this->adapter);
1481
        $storage = Storage::getInstance($this->config, $this->adapter);
1502
 
1482
 
1503
        /*
1483
        /*